Plugin authors: Branchsweep deletes branches with no commits in 90 days, excluding anything matching protected patterns. Your plugin's test fixtures should cover three cases: a stale branch eligible for deletion, a stale-but-protected branch, and a branch revived by a push during the grace window. The sandbox repo resets nightly, so schedule long-running tests accordingly. Deletion events are emitted to the webhook relay; verify your handler acknowledges within 10 seconds. To query the sandbox API, authenticate with the token below.

session JWT of yawep-yawep = eyJhbGciOiJIUzI1NiIsInR5cCI6IkpXVCJ9.eyJzdWIiOiI3pWF3_In0.aXYsHiog

**Q: We replaced the homegrown job queue — what if legacy jobs resurface?**

Old Tinwhistle jobs may still land in the deprecated table after the Ferncastle migration. Don't reprocess them manually; run the drain script, which replays them through the new broker with dedup enabled. If the drain script can't reach the legacy credentials store, unlock it with the recovery phrase below.

unlock words, yaguf-fajep: praiel-kasdor-druax-wenix-fenok-juldor-eliox-zordor-novath-quenir

## Garagemeter Occupancy Feed — Restart

If the Lot-Vista dashboard shows stale counts for more than five minutes, restart the feed worker on the Garagemeter host. Check the sensor bridge first; a wedged bridge makes restarts pointless. Do not touch the gate controllers. The worker reads its settings at boot, shown below.

deployment values, kajep-kageg:
[praix]
host = praix.paliqcorp.corp
user = praix_svc
database = praix_prod

## Runbook: Ferngate stale-cache recovery

So, the short version from the postmortem: Ferngate's read layer happily served week-old pricing because the cache key didn't include the region suffix. Classic. We fixed the key scheme, but if you ever see mismatched prices again, flush the regional caches first and check the key-builder version before blaming the database. Don't hand-edit anything in prod — future you will regret it. When rebuilding a node, apply exactly the configuration values listed below.

config for hahaf-kafof:
[wenys]
host = wenys.torvahq.corp
user = wenys_svc
database = wenys_prod